What does Carley mean and where does it come from?
Carley is a variant of the name Carly, which itself is derived from the Old English surname 'Carl', meaning 'man' or 'free man'. The story of Carley
Carley entered American naming records in 1921 and has been in use for over 103 years. A total of 16,927 babies have received this name. The name has grown more popular over time, rising from #3554 in 1925 to #1278 in 2023. Carley is used for both genders: 98% female and 2% male.
